Pipeline system is an important part of a region’s infrastructure. And to keep a regular inspection and maintenance of the pipes and sewers, especially those with limiting diameter, robots are introduced. And to allow a flexible movement of the in-pipe robots while allowing a stable transmission of video signals, slip rings are essential components.
JINPAT Electronics, as a competitive slip ring provider, offers practical slip ring and rotary joint solutions for in-pipe robots.

Generally speaking, through bore slip ring series is good choice for pipe inspection robots. LPT025-0420-0607 and LPT000-0213 are two slip ring models that transmit solely power. Having many channels and they able to transmit large current. These hollow shaft slip rings are applied in middle-size and large-size pipe robot. To be more specific, these through bore slip rings are generally installed in the cable reel of the control center.
Talking about small-size pipe robot, LPC-24A-0216-0202, LPC-18A-01-0802-HD01, LPMS-06B-06S and LPM-12F-0802-HD01 are the basic slip ring models being chosen. Take LPMS-06B-06S electrical slip ring for example, there are 2 signal channels, 1 analog video signal channel and 2 channels for other signals. LPM-12F-0802-HD01 is a hybrid slip ring model with capability to transmit high definition video signals. Slip rings as these can be installed on the camera joint on the pipe robots. They are compact in size and with high protection grade.
